Coat of Arms↕ | House or Institution↕ | Country↕ | Adopted↕ | Key Charges↕ |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Habsburg double-eagle | House of Habsburg | Austria, Holy Roman Empire | 15th century | Double-headed eagle |
| Bourbon fleur-de-lis | House of Bourbon | France | 12th century | Azure, three fleurs-de-lis or |
| Royal Arms of the UK | British monarchy | United Kingdom | 1837 (current form) | Lions, harp, unicorn, lion supporters |
| Vatican keys | Holy See | Vatican City | 14th century | Crossed silver and gold keys, tiara |
| Romanov double-eagle | House of Romanov | Russian Empire | 1497 | Double-headed eagle, St George |
| Tudor rose | House of Tudor | England | 1486 | Red and white rose conjoined |
| Medici palle | House of Medici | Florence | 13th century | Six golden balls on a gold field |
| Hohenzollern quartered | House of Hohenzollern | Prussia, Germany | 12th century | Black and white quartered |
| Plantagenet lions | House of Plantagenet | England | 1198 | Three gold lions on red |
| Savoy cross | House of Savoy | Italy | 11th century | Silver cross on red |
| Jagiellon knight | Jagiellonian dynasty | Poland-Lithuania | 14th century | White eagle, mounted knight |
| Ottoman tughra | House of Osman | Ottoman Empire | 15th century | Calligraphic tughra and trophy |
| Valois fleur-de-lis | House of Valois | France | 1328 | Azure, three fleurs-de-lis or |
| Braganza wyvern | House of Braganza | Portugal | 1640 | Five blue shields, wyvern crest |
| Capetian fleur-de-lis | House of Capet | France | 12th century | Azure semy of fleurs-de-lis or |
